OVIDE. Métamorphoses en rondeaux imprimez et enrichis de figures par ordre de Sa Majesté et dédiez à Monseigneur le Dauphin. Paris, Imprimerie Royale, 1676; in-folio, contemporary red morocco binding, gilt fillets and arms on boards, spine ribbed and decorated with flowers and gilt motifs, inner lace and gilt edges.
First edition of the translation-adaptation in verse of the Metamorphoses by Isaac de Benserade. It is decorated in the first edition with 226 FIGURES IN THE TEXT ENGRAVED ON COPPER BY FRANÇOIS CHAUVEAU, SÉBASTIEN LE CLERC AND JEAN LE PAUTRE.
Small brown marks on the two preliminary blank leaves.
BOUND IN RED MOROCCO WITH THE ARMS OF LOUIS XIV. From the library of Alfred Piet with ex-libris.
